π¨ What to Do Immediately After Water Damage
- Ensure safety first β Turn off electricity to affected areas. Do not enter standing water near electrical outlets.
- Stop the water source β Shut off the main water valve for burst pipes. For flooding, focus on containment.
- Document everything β Take photos and videos of all damage for insurance claims.
- Call professionals within one business day β Contact an IICRC-certified restoration company. Fast response reduces secondary damage risk.
- Begin emergency mitigation β Move wet items from walls, place furniture on blocks, ventilate if outdoor humidity is low.
- File an insurance claim β Contact your insurer promptly. Most policies require notification within 24-72 hours.

How much does water damage restoration cost in California?
Minor water damage costs $500-$1,500. Moderate damage ranges from $2,000-$5,000. Major restoration with structural repairs can cost $5,000-$15,000 or more. Costs vary by extent, materials affected, and response time.
Does homeowners insurance cover water damage?
Most policies cover sudden and accidental water damage from burst pipes, appliance failures, or storm damage. Gradual damage from neglect or maintenance issues is typically excluded. Review your policy details and consider additional flood insurance.
What factors affect water damage restoration costs?
Key factors include the volume of water, category of water (clean, gray, or black), affected materials, square footage, mold risk, and response time. Faster response reduces overall costs significantly.
